Restricted Projects Sample Clauses

Restricted Projects. SPSS shall not, without AOL's prior written consent, accept or execute any project using AOL Sample if such project is (i) intended to target or identify AOL Members or AOL membership (provided, however, that this restriction shall not apply to AOLTW internal projects) or (ii) is on behalf of an AOLTW Competitor.

Restricted Projects. The process set forth in Section 10.3 shall be modified as set forth in this Section 10.4 with respect to Restricted Projects. An Offer Notice for any Restricted Project(s) shall provide that a Purchase Offer for such Restricted Project(s) must be delivered by Regency to GRI within eleven (11) months following Regency’s receipt of such Offer Notice (or such earlier date determined by Regency); provided that if Regency submits a Purchase Offer at any time, then the process for any such Restricted Project(s) shall be governed by Section 10.3 and the provisions of this Section 10.4 shall not be applicable with respect to such Restricted Project(s). Unless Regency provides a Purchase Offer or other Notification to GRI to the contrary, the closing of the sale of a Restricted Project cannot be consummated prior to the date that is fifteen (15) months following Regency’s receipt of the Offer Notice for such Restricted Project.
Restricted Projects. (i) Subject to Section 3.3(f) and Section 3.3(g), no Member (either directly or indirectly through one or more of its Affiliates) will own, operate, manage, control, engage in, participate in, invest in, finance, render services for, assist others in, or otherwise carry out the Primary Business (a “Restricted Project”) other than through the Company, except that (A) Rice or its Affiliates may engage in a Restricted Project outside the Company if such Restricted Project is presented to the Company and the Rice Board Designees vote in favor of pursuing such Restricted Project through the Company, but the pursuit of such Restricted Project by the Company does not receive Unanimous Board Approval and (B) Gulfport or its Affiliates may engage in a Restricted Project outside the Company if such Restricted Project is presented to the Company and the Gulfport Board Designees vote in favor of pursuing such Restricted Project through the Company, but the pursuit of such Restricted Project by the Company does not receive Unanimous Board Approval; provided, that, in the case of each of the foregoing clauses (A) and (B), any such Restricted Project that does not receive Unanimous Board Approval shall be a Sole Risk Project subject to the terms and conditions of Section 3.3(f) and any other applicable terms of this Agreement.
